Colombian Dances Clarinet Duets by Mauricio Murcia Bedoya

Colombian Dances Clarinet Duets by Mauricio Murcia Bedoya. Woodwindiana, 2008, SB, 18 pages. Mauricio Murcia Bedoya (1976-) was born in Colombia where he studied clarinet and conducting and at the time this was written was studying for a master's degree in clarinet performance in the United States. There are four duets (in score format): Saturday (Latin Jazz), Sabroso (Good taste, based on popular rhythms from the Caribbean part of Colombia, Natalia (Pasillo, derived from the waltz of the Andina region of Colombia), and Mauro's Latin (Latin Jazz). These duets are at the college level but may also be enjoyed by good adult amateurs. (C1325)
